Following the footballer’s retrial failure, Giggs and his fiancée were last seen together in public in July.

The prosecution has withdrawn the retrial of Premier League legend Ryan Giggs, which was scheduled to begin on July 31.

Between 1990 and 2014, Ryan Giggs appeared in 672 games for Manchester United.

The former midfielder is one of only 28 players in football history to have played in more than 1,000 matches.

He took over League Two club Salford City in 2014, alongside a number of Manchester United legends, while also serving as Wales national team manager from 2018 to 2022.
